Cliveden is a 19th-century Italianate mansion overlooking the Thames, once home to the Astor family and now run as a hotel, with its grounds open to day visitors via the National Trust. Reviewers rate the gardens and woodland walks highly across seasons, from winter to spring, though several note that National Trust tickets cover the grounds only, not the house itself.

Reviewers consistently describe Cliveden's grounds as stunning in every season, from winter walks to spring blossom, with the maze and the views over the Thames mentioned repeatedly as highlights. Staff and volunteers are praised as friendly, knowledgeable and welcoming throughout. A recurring caveat is that National Trust tickets only cover the grounds, not Cliveden House itself which operates as a hotel, and one reviewer felt this made the ticket price feel a little high outside of promotional offers. The estate's paths are noted as excellent for long walks or jogging, with plenty of ground to cover across a full day.
